Ad exchanges can seem complicated at the glance, but the core idea isn't very challenging to get. Essentially, they're digital marketplaces where businesses can programmatically secure ad space from websites who have space they want to monetize. Think of it as an auction; when a user visits a website, an ad exchange rapidly analyzes their profile and presents the best advertisement that fits their behavior. This dynamic process guarantees that advertisers are just contributing for ad impressions that exhibit a potential of influencing their target audience.

Real-Time Bidding and the Digital Platform Environment

Real-Time Bidding (RTB) represents a pivotal shift in how online ads are bought . It functions within a complex digital marketplace ecosystem , where publishers offer their ad space for auction in milliseconds. Advertisers, through sophisticated auctioning systems, bid in real-time for the right to present their ads to relevant audiences. This fast-paced process removes traditional approaches of ad purchasing , fostering greater effectiveness and precision for businesses.
